Who is Derrick Campbell?
Derrick Nathan Campbell is a Canadian short track speed skater who competed in the 1994 Winter Olympics and in the 1998 Winter Olympics.
He was born in Cambridge, Ontario.
In 1994 he was a member of the Canadian relay team which finished fourth in the 5000 metre relay competition. In the 1000 m event he finished sixth and in the 500 m contest he finished eleventh.
Four years later he won the gold medal with the Canadian team in the 5000 metre relay competition.
He was also training Francois Hamelin.
